1959 Abarth 850 vs. 1999 Peugeot Nautilus
To start off, 1999 Peugeot Nautilus is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Abarth 850.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Abarth 850 would be higher. At 2,946 cc (6 cylinders), 1999 Peugeot Nautilus is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Peugeot Nautilus (191 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 121 more horse power than 1959 Abarth 850. (70 HP @ 6800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1999 Peugeot Nautilus should accelerate faster than 1959 Abarth 850.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Peugeot Nautilus weights approximately 1420 kg more than 1959 Abarth 850.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1999 Peugeot Nautilus (267 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 187 more torque (in Nm) than 1959 Abarth 850. (80 Nm @ 4800 RPM). This means 1999 Peugeot Nautilus will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1959 Abarth 850.
